Hi, I´m having problems to configure wireshark to open on my system without root privilegies. I read your page about orientation but can´t get understand this part: " # groupadd -g packetcapture # chmod 750 /usr/bin/dumpcap # chgrp packetcapture /usr/bin/dumpcap # setcap cap_net_raw,cap_net_admin+eip /usr/bin/dumpcap In the last line, the setcap command isn´t recognize.
It looks like setcap is part of the libcap package (which is different from libpcap) on Red Hat.
